2007 Dodge Grand Caravan vs. 2001 Volvo S80

To start off, 2007 Dodge Grand Caravan is newer by 6 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2001 Volvo S80.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2001 Volvo S80 would be higher. At 3,778 cc (6 cylinders), 2007 Dodge Grand Caravan is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Dodge Grand Caravan (201 HP @ 5200 RPM) has 40 more horse power than 2001 Volvo S80. (161 HP @ 4000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2007 Dodge Grand Caravan should accelerate faster than 2001 Volvo S80.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2001 Volvo S80 weights approximately 180 kg more than 2007 Dodge Grand Caravan.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2001 Volvo S80 (350 Nm @ 1750 RPM) has 31 more torque (in Nm) than 2007 Dodge Grand Caravan. (319 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2001 Volvo S80 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2007 Dodge Grand Caravan.
